EDIT: I found Selsun Blue Gold 2.5% Selenium Sulfide on Amazon JP! Turns out it's made in Australia and I just had to do some basic math to get the percentage. For ¥5600 ($36 USD) it's the same price as Nizoral 1% Ketoconazol in the US. Thank you for all the help!

Here's the math:
25mg/ml Selenium Sulfide

200 ml Bottle

25 mg/ml * 200 ml = 5000 mg = 5 g of Selenium Sulfide for the entire bottle

Water = 1 kg/liter = 1000 g/liter (this is density)

Assuming the both densities of:

the bottle's substance = water

This means the 200 ml bottle's contents roughly weight 200 g

5 g Selenium Sulfide/200 g Bottle Contents= 0.025= 2.5%

I.e. 2.5 % of the bottle is Selenium Sulfide 😀
